WebOct 16, 2024 · Generally, the cases of Lewy Body Dementia are not considered to be inherited. It occurs irregularly or periodically in people even if they don’t have a family history. In rare cases, it has been seen that the disease can affect more than one family member. WebJan 12, 2024 · FAQ. Summary. Most cases of Lewy body dementia (LBD) are not hereditary. However, you can inherit a genetic change that increases your chances of developing LBD. Knowing your family history and undergoing genetic testing may tell you more about your risk. Lewy body dementia (LBD) is one of the most common dementia …
